在服务器上创建和打开本地用户通常涉及几个步骤,这些步骤可能因操作系统的不同而有所差异,以下是针对Windows Server和Linux服务器的一般指导。
Windows Server 上创建和打开本地用户
1、登录服务器:使用管理员账户登录到你的Windows Server。
2、打开计算机管理:
点击“开始”菜单,选择“运行”。
输入compmgmt.msc
并按回车,这将打开计算机管理控制台。
3、导航到本地用户和组:
在左侧面板中,展开“系统工具”,然后点击“本地用户和组”。
选择“用户”文件夹,你将看到当前系统中的所有本地用户列表。
4、创建新用户:
右键点击右侧面板的空白处,选择“新建用户”。
填写用户名、密码(确保符合复杂性要求),并提供用户全名等详细信息。
取消选中“用户下次登录时须更改密码”选项,除非你希望强制用户首次登录时更改密码。
点击“创建”按钮完成用户创建。
5、配置用户权限:
双击刚创建的用户,进入其属性窗口。
切换到“隶属于”标签页,点击“添加”按钮,将用户添加到适当的用户组(如“Users”或“Administrators”)。
确认后关闭所有窗口。
6、登录测试:尝试使用新创建的用户登录服务器,确保一切设置正确。
1、登录服务器:使用root账户或具有sudo权限的用户登录到你的Linux服务器。
2、创建新用户:
打开终端。
输入以下命令来创建一个新用户(以username
替换为实际用户名):
sudo useradd -m -s /bin/bash username
这里,-m
选项用于创建用户的主目录,-s /bin/bash
指定了用户的默认shell。
接着为新用户设置密码:
sudo passwd username
按照提示输入并确认密码。
3、配置用户权限:
如果需要将用户添加到特定的用户组(如sudo
组),可以使用以下命令:
sudo usermod -aG sudo username
4、切换用户:
要切换到新创建的用户,可以输入:
su username
或者使用ssh
从远程登录时直接指定用户:
ssh username@server_ip
5、验证登录:尝试使用新用户登录,确保一切正常。
Q1: 我忘记了本地用户的密码怎么办?
A1: 对于Windows Server,你可以在“计算机管理”的“本地用户和组”中选择该用户,然后选择“设置密码”,对于Linux,你可以使用passwd username
命令来重置密码。
Q2: 如何在不使用图形界面的情况下创建和管理用户?
A2: 在Linux中,你可以通过编辑/etc/passwd
和/etc/group
文件来手动添加用户和组,但更推荐使用命令行工具如useradd
,groupadd
,usermod
,passwd
等进行管理,在Windows中,虽然主要通过图形界面管理用户,但也可以通过PowerShell或命令提示符使用net user
命令来创建和管理用户。
管理服务器上的本地用户是维护系统安全和组织资源访问的重要方面,无论是Windows还是Linux服务器,了解如何有效地创建、管理和删除用户都是系统管理员的基本技能,记得定期审查用户权限,确保只授予必要的访问权,以减少潜在的安全风险,保持密码策略的严格性也是保护服务器免受未授权访问的关键措施之一。